Job Objective:
Provides leadership for the administration, direction and ongoing development of the Case Management department. Is responsible for ensuring that appropriate utilization of resources is accomplished through efforts that are cost effective, safe, clinically appropriate, and enhance quality of care. Promotes and facilitates appropriate admission status, and facilitates movement through the healthcare continuum by implementing processes that ensure timely and proactive care coordination and discharge planning. Integrates department services with other departments and medical staff initiatives.

RN Case managers must meet the following qualifications:
Education
Required: Bachelor’s degree in Nursing
Preferred: Master’s Degree in Health Related field
Licensure/Certification
Required: CA RN License
Experience
Required: 3 years experience in Case Management field and minimum 3 years previous managerial experience
Required: Experience in Acute Hospital Case Management field
Preferred: 5 years in Case Management and 5 year’s previous managerial experience
Specialty Skills:
Supervisory/management experience, preferable in the area of case management
Well developed organizational and communication skills.
Ability to develop and direct all elements of the Case Management process within the hospital system.
Knowledge of regulatory, state and federal guidelines pertaining to Case Management processes and continuum of care strategies.
Well developed critical thinking and problem solving skills
Knowledge of Case Management and Social Services roles and processes.
